4.  Check fans. Are they on? 
- YES: Continue. 
-  NO: Go to “Fans Do Not Turn” procedure on 
page 10. 
5.  Check video on monitor. Does the picture roll? 
-  YES: Use the video controller or switcher to 
synchronize video vertical sync phases of all 
domes to the ac line. For specific 
instructions, see the installation and service 
manual for the controller or switcher. 
- NO: Continue. 
Is the picture normal? 
-  YES: See “Detailed Troubleshooting” in the 
installation and service manual supplied with 
the dome. 
-  NO: See “Poor or No Video” on page 10. 
Fans Do Not Turn 
Follow steps until the problem is corrected. See 
page 5 to order parts. 
1.  Determine if the dome camera is receiving 
power. Look for evidence such as a picture on 
the video monitor or dome movement. 
2.  Detach the dome camera to access the 
environmental PC board. 
Note: Power to fans comes from the dome. 
Fans will not function with the dome removed. 
CAUTION: Touch the metal housing before 
handling the environmental PC board. 
3.  Verify power is reaching the housing. Press and 
hold switch SW2 and observe the green (ac 
power) LED; it should glow steadily. If not, 
check power at the J-box and check that the ac 
cable is plugged into connector P7 on the top 
side of the environmental PC board. 
CAUTION: Use a 2.5mm (0.1in) slotted 
screwdriver. Using a blade too wide can 
damage connectors. 
CAUTION: Screws on the connector P1 are 
delicate. DO NOT over tighten them! 
4.  Check the fan connector. Is it plugged into 
connector P5 on other side of the environmental 
PC board? 
-  YES: Replace fan/heater assembly 0400-
0935-01. Remove two screws to remove 
assembly. 
-  NO: Plug the connector in, reinstall the 
environmental PC board, and reconnect the 
dome. If fans still do not work, replace the 
fan/heater assembly.
